Billy Joel and Sting kick off a co-headline show with a remarkable duet.
Billy Joel very much seems to be enjoying himself these days, having just released his first new music in 17 years while inching towards his 150th performance at Madison Square Garden.
All the while he's continued touring, and is currently on the road in the US with support on various dates from Stevie Nicks and Sting.
The shows with Sting have been billed as co-headlining dates, and what better way to underline that than for Billy to introduce Sting on stage, before joining him for his opening number at the Raymond James Stadium in Tampa, Florida.
"Stick around and sing with me," Sting asked his touring buddy, and Joel was more than happy to oblige.
The pair performed The Police hit 'Every Little Thing She Does Is Magic', before Joel took his leave to prepare for his own set later that evening.
Billy Joel and Sting @ Tampa 2/24/24 - Every Little Thing She Does Is Magic
And during Billy Joel's own set, Sting returned the favour from earlier in the evening by joining him for a run through 'Big Man on Mulberry Street'.
While he has stopped performing the controversial 'Don't Stand So Close To Me', Sting's setlist was packed with career-spanning hits.
